index.js 719 B

1234567891011121314151617181920212223242526272829303132333435
  1. import { createRouter, createWebHashHistory } from 'vue-router'
  2. import HomeView from '../views/HomeView.vue'
  3. import PortalView from '../views/PortalView.vue'
  4. import UserStoryChatView from '../views/UserStoryChatView.vue'
  5. import LoginView from '../views/LoginView.vue'
  6. const routes = [
  7. {
  8. path: '/',
  9. name: 'Home',
  10. component: HomeView
  11. },
  12. {
  13. path: '/portal',
  14. name: 'Portal',
  15. component: PortalView
  16. },
  17. {
  18. path: '/login',
  19. name: 'Login',
  20. component: LoginView
  21. },
  22. {
  23. path: '/user-story-chat',
  24. name: 'UserStoryChat',
  25. component: UserStoryChatView
  26. }
  27. ]
  28. const router = createRouter({
  29. history: createWebHashHistory(location.pathname),
  30. routes
  31. })
  32. export default router